Normal Mole Removal Costs
The mole removal cost can extend from around $100 to $500 or more per mole. There could be a breakdown of the normal costs related to distinctive strategies of mole removal:- Extraction: This surgical strategy includes cutting out the mole and sewing the wound. It is compelling for bigger and possibly cancerous moles. The fetch for extraction regularly falls within $100 to $500.
- Laser Removal: Laser treatment could be a non-surgical choice for removing moles. More often than not, costs run from $100 to $500 per session, with different sessions in some cases required.
- Shaving: Shaving may be a non-surgical strategy for smaller moles, where the mole is shaved off the skin's surface. It tends to be on the lower conclusion of the fetched range, regularly around $100 to $300.
